To pronounce "conspirator", say CONSP-ir-at-or — 4 syllables, IPA /kənˈspɪɹətə/. Tap play below to hear it in four English accents, or practice it syllable by syllable.

"Conspirator" has 4 syllables: consp · ir · at · or.
The IPA transcription of "conspirator" is /kənˈspɪɹətə/.
Conspirator: One of a group that acts in harmony; a person who is part of a conspiracy.
